Transaction 284fdc656487de96c6f61457466953dd4cc58e4bef92e90083843885da41c645
1 Input
2 Outputs
- 284fdc656487de96c6f61457466953dd4cc58e4bef92e90083843885da41c645:0
- 284fdc656487de96c6f61457466953dd4cc58e4bef92e90083843885da41c645:1
value 473770095
address 1KwpkjrJjVhJLKPyHsEdJXDvR7BQ6zrtMj
value 2958076
address 17EwJGze4fG9Pe2cTSEA2wT6BrDcHc9KqF